What they do
A Registered Nurse provides medical care and treatment, educates patients about their conditions, and provides emotional support to patients and families. Works in hospitals, schools, clinics or community health centers. Works under the supervision of a physician or other specialist, and serves as the primary point of care for patients in a hospital setting. May specialize in emergency room work, or treatment for a particular condition, or specialize in working with infants, the elderly or other patient groups. May work as an advanced practice specialists and prescribe medications in addition to offering specialty care.

Avamere Olympic Rehabilitation - 1000 S 5th Ave, Sequim, WA 98382 Apply at www.TeamAvamere.com Job Summary In Washington State, a Nurse Technician is a nursing student who works under the supervision of a registered nurse to provide direct patient care. This position performs a range of tasks based on their academic progress and skills, as defined by the supervising RN and the Washington Administrative Code (WAC). This includes assisting with patient care, gathering information, and performing specific nursing functions. Essential Duties and Job Responsibilities Nurse Technicians assist registered nurses in providing direct patient care, including tasks like taking vital signs, assisting with mobility, hygiene, and toileting needs. They collect and document patient information, including vital signs and other relevant data, and report any changes to the supervising RN. They play a role in maintaining a safe and clean environment for patients and staff, including stocking supplies and reporting safety concerns. They communicate with the supervising RN about patient status and collaborate with other healthcare professionals to ensure coordinated care. They may provide emotional support to patients and their families and assist them with information. Collaborates effectively with the nursing team, physicians, other departments, and external providers to coordinate patient care activities. Participate in team meetings and discussions to contribute to care planning and problem-solving. Must be enrolled in an approved LPN or RN accredited program in good standing and has completed at least one academic term with a clinical component.
